From eec7e789a87863c25d92c10ad5dfc22ad80c448d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期二, 14 七月 2020 12:36:48 +0800 Subject: [PATCH] 系统区分BUG修复 --- fanli/src/main/java/com/yeshi/fanli/service/inter/config/ConfigService.java | 60 ++++++++++++++++++++++++++++++------------------------------ 1 files changed, 30 insertions(+), 30 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/service/inter/config/ConfigService.java b/fanli/src/main/java/com/yeshi/fanli/service/inter/config/ConfigService.java index fc67a2b..69dfdbd 100644 --- a/fanli/src/main/java/com/yeshi/fanli/service/inter/config/ConfigService.java +++ b/fanli/src/main/java/com/yeshi/fanli/service/inter/config/ConfigService.java @@ -2,6 +2,8 @@ import java.util.List; +import com.yeshi.fanli.entity.SystemEnum; +import com.yeshi.fanli.entity.system.ConfigKeyEnum; import org.yeshi.utils.entity.ProxyIP; import com.yeshi.fanli.entity.common.Config; @@ -10,7 +12,7 @@ public interface ConfigService { - List<Config> getAllList(); + List<Config> getAllList(SystemEnum system); void update(List<Config> list); @@ -18,11 +20,13 @@ void save(Config config); - String get(String string); + String getValue(String string,SystemEnum system); + + String getValue(ConfigKeyEnum key, SystemEnum system); - String getByVersion(String key,String platform,int version); + String getByVersion(String key,String platform,int version,SystemEnum system); - Config getConfig(String key); + Config getConfig(String key,SystemEnum system); /** * 灏忕▼搴忚缃� @@ -31,25 +35,24 @@ * @param version * @return */ - boolean xcxShow(String appId, Integer version); + boolean xcxShow(String appId, Integer version,SystemEnum system); + /** * 灏忕▼搴忚缃� - * - * @param appId - * @param version + * @param ghId * @return */ - XCXSettingConfig getXCXInfoByGhId(String ghId); + XCXSettingConfig getXCXInfoByGhId(String ghId,SystemEnum system); /** * H5鍩熷悕閰嶇疆 * * @return */ - String getH5Host(); + String getH5Host(SystemEnum system); - boolean iosOnLining(int version); + boolean iosOnLining(int version,SystemEnum system); /** * 鏄惁闇�瑕佸湪鏈嶅姟鍣ㄥ唴閮ㄨ浆閾� @@ -57,28 +60,22 @@ * @return */ - boolean isConvertTaoBaoLinkInServer(); + boolean isConvertTaoBaoLinkInServer(SystemEnum system); /** * 鑾峰彇棣栭〉鎮诞澶у浘 * * @return */ - AppHomeFloatImg getAppHomeFloatImg(); + AppHomeFloatImg getAppHomeFloatImg(SystemEnum system); /** * 鑾峰彇棣栭〉鎻愮ず澶у浘 * * @return */ - String getAppHomeFloatNotifyImg(); + String getAppHomeFloatNotifyImg(SystemEnum system); - /** - * 鑾峰彇棣栭〉weex鐨勯摼鎺� - * - * @return - */ - public String getHomeWEEXUrl(); /** * 鍚庣鏌ヨ鍒嗛〉 @@ -87,16 +84,15 @@ * @param page * @return */ - public List<Config> listObjects(String key, int page); + public List<Config> listObjects(String key, int page,SystemEnum system); /** * 鍚庣鏌ヨ缁熻 - * * @param key - * @param page + * @param system * @return */ - public int getCount(String key); + public int getCount(String key,SystemEnum system); public Config getConfig(long id); @@ -105,31 +101,35 @@ * * @return */ - public ProxyIP getTaoBaoProxyIP(); + public ProxyIP getTaoBaoProxyIP(SystemEnum system); /** * 鎼滅储鍙戠幇璇� * @return */ - public String getSearchDiscoveryKeys(); + public String getSearchDiscoveryKeys(SystemEnum system); /** * 鏍规嵁key鏌ヨ 鏃犵紦瀛� * @param key * @return */ - public Config getConfigBykeyNoCache(String key); + public Config getConfigBykeyNoCache(String key,SystemEnum system); + /** * 浜戝彂鍗曟槸鍚﹀紑鍚� - * @param uid + * @param key + * @param system + * @param platform + * @param version * @return */ - public boolean isRobotCloudOpen(String key); + public boolean isRobotCloudOpen(String key,String platform,String version,SystemEnum system); /** * 娴嬭瘯鐢ㄦ埛淇℃伅 * @return */ - public List<String> getTestUsers(); + public List<String> getTestUsers(SystemEnum system); } -- Gitblit v1.8.0